Output 24880d8b25fa60d54772e815ae40c12295513e3f9ff359e0d218cf4d89de103e:0

value
66200
script pubkey
OP_0 OP_PUSHBYTES_20 11692ea73bc5928f7b1b68e82992ff7e1926b395
address
bc1qz95jafemckfg77cmdr5znyhl0cvjdvu47xfw6q
transaction
24880d8b25fa60d54772e815ae40c12295513e3f9ff359e0d218cf4d89de103e
confirmations
184925
spent
true